Residential Geothermal Energy Diagram The cooled fluid returns to the ground loop to repeat the cycle. in cooling mode, the geothermal heat pump removes excess heat from the home and deposits it into the earth, providing a consistent and comfortable indoor environment. here are the steps the system takes to cool your home. the indoor unit extracts heat from your home’s air. Geothermal heat pumps come in four types of loop systems that loop the heat to or from the ground and your house. three of these – hori zontal, vertical, and pond lake – are closed loop systems. the fourth type of system is the open loop option. choosing the one that is best for your site depends on the climate, soil conditions, available.

How Does Geothermal Heating Cooling Work The biggest downside to installing a geothermal heat pump is the cost. the system and installation can range from $10,000 to $40,000 depending on your soil conditions, plot size, system configuration, site accessibility and the amount of digging and drilling required. for a typical 2,000 sq. ft. home, a geothermal retrofit can cost up to $30,000. A geothermal heat pump, also known as a ground source heat pump, is a heating and cooling system that leverages the constant temperature of the earth to provide heat in the winter and cool air in the summer. unlike traditional heating systems that burn fuel to generate heat, geothermal heat pumps use a heat exchange process with the ground to. An underground heat collector —a geothermal heat pump uses the earth as a heat source and sink (thermal storage), using a series of connected pipes buried in the ground near a building. the loop can be buried either vertically or horizontally. it circulates a fluid that absorbs or deposits heat to the surrounding soil, depending on whether. Here’s the short explanation: as air is circulated through your house, your heat pump removes heat from the air and transfers it to the fluid that circulates to the ground. as the ground is at a lower temperature (55f), heat dissipates from the fluid to the ground. the experience of cold air blowing into your home is the result of the process.
